Demographics - New Brighton, MN

New Brighton has a population of 23,500 residents, offering a diverse community with a median age of nearly 40 and a balanced gender ratio. The area features a strong blend of backgrounds, with about 79% White, 7% Black, and 8% Asian residents, and over 12% speaking a language other than English at home. Its high population density contributes to a lively suburban atmosphere.

Cost Of Living

What is the average cost of living in New Brighton, MN?

The cost of living in New Brighton is higher than the national average, with a cost of living index of 105.7. Median home values are around $330,000 and average rents for a two-bedroom apartment are approximately $1,370. Utilities, groceries, and transportation costs are also elevated, reflecting the area's desirable location and amenities.

Crime

Is New Brighton, MN a safe place to live?

New Brighton is considered a safe community, with a low violent crime rate of 130 incidents per 100,000 residents and a property crime chance of 1 in 48. Most residents enjoy peace of mind, making it an attractive choice for families. The crime index remains below many urban areas in Minnesota.

Weather

What is the weather like in New Brighton, MN year-round?

New Brighton experiences four distinct seasons, with warm summers reaching highs of 83°F and cold winters dipping to 7°F. The area receives about 31 inches of rainfall annually and enjoys sunshine on 59% of days. This climate offers residents a balanced mix of outdoor opportunities year-round.

Education

How are the schools in New Brighton, MN?

New Brighton offers quality education options, with public schools like Irondale High School and Bel Air Elementary School known for favorable student-to-teacher ratios. Families also have access to private schools and several nearby colleges, including Bethel University and University of Minnesota - Twin Cities. The community is committed to educational excellence for all age groups.

Housing Market

What is the housing market like in New Brighton, MN?

The local housing market is strong, with a median home price of $330,000 and an owner-occupied rate of nearly 67%. The market has seen a 4.3% appreciation over the past year, and rental vacancy rates remain moderate at 4.7%. New Brighton offers a mix of stability and opportunity for both buyers and renters.
